Can't browse internet via bluetooth

Hi guys..

I am new to Axim X50v. I managed to connect my PPC to the PC via bluetooth for internet, however, when I open Internet Explorer, the webpages doesn't come out. Do I need to configure my IE before I can browse?

I tried my wireless connection for internet at a open cafe, it WORKS.

Wonder why? Any wisdom willing to share?

Through BT to the PC you can tunnel the traffic through Activesync - or you can share your network adaptor in the BT profile on the PC and enable Internet Sharing through that.

Which one are you trying to do?
